Subject: Welcome — garage occupancy feed notes

Hi, and welcome to the Stallworth on-call rotation. The parking-garage occupancy feed polls sensor gateways at each Corvane-managed garage every 30 seconds. The most common page is a stale-feed alarm, which usually means a gateway rebooted and needs a manual re-registration. Please document anything unusual you see, since these notes become the reference for future maintainers. The full feed architecture and troubleshooting checklist are kept on the internal page.

operations page: https://jira.qorvelsys.internal/browse/pages/browse/pages

Night shift note: the roof-terrace door at Danner Point jams in cold weather — the latch sticks, not the lock. Push firmly at the top corner; never wedge it open, as the alarm trips after two minutes. Report repeat faults to the overnight facilities line. To release the magnetic lock from inside, key in the code below.

staff pass of kawip-hawef = bdg-QLP-2

Dear Quarrystone integration partners,

We want to document, for your support team, how sorting stability works in the Veldmark report builder. Sorts are guaranteed stable: rows equal on the sort key retain their prior order, so layered sorts behave predictably across exports. To verify this behavior against our sandbox reporting endpoint, please authenticate using the token below.

session JWT of yawep-yawep = eyJhbGciOiJIUzI1NiIsInR5cCI6IkpXVCJ9.eyJzdWIiOiI3pWF3_In0.aXYsHiog

## Ticket: Config drift on Fernvale partner SFTP drop

The Fernvale SFTP drop in production no longer matches the approved baseline — polling interval and retention were changed by hand last sprint. Before the next release cut, the live settings must be reconciled. For reference, the approved baseline configuration is as follows.

deployment values, yadug-bawif:
[framir]
team = pelox
access_code = ac_a38ab2
owner = tamion.julael
host = framir.tolvaqlabs.test
port = 11211
peer = tammir.zemvargrid.local
salt = 2215ef03
pin = 1541

Facilities Ticket — Cleaning Crew Access, Brindle Annex

For new starters handling evening lock-up: the Sorano Cleaning crew arrives nightly at 21:30 via the annex side door. Check their rota sheet, note arrival in the log, and ensure the storeroom is relocked afterward. To let them through the side door, enter the access code below.

badge for yaweg-hafog: bdg-GX-6